Transaction f32315675c32c4d41d7cc27f17cd76a755bc329666f0b53827e836dfba76a8da
1 Input
1 Output
-
f32315675c32c4d41d7cc27f17cd76a755bc329666f0b53827e836dfba76a8da:0
- value
- 8452692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93009f3a7bbc429510275d9c974861e0fc962cdb OP_EQUAL
- address
- 3F6Hzxaw9KQDxDK8jBfPX8Y33EASNsvewH